Vis Constructions Pty Ltd & Anor v Cockburn & Anor [2006] QSC 416

ADMINISTRATIVE LAW – JUDICIAL REVIEW – GROUNDS OF REVIEW – PROCEDURAL FAIRNESS – EXISTENCE OF OBLIGATION – GENERALLY – application to review adjudication decision under Building and Construction Industry Payments Act 2004 – whether decision is regulated by the rules of natural justice - ADMINISTRATIVE LAW – JUDICIAL REVIEW – GROUNDS OF REVIEW – JURISDICTIONAL MATTERS – applicants seek to have set aside adjudication decision pursuant to the Building and Construction Industry Payments Act 2004 – under the Act the adjudicator must have regard to the construction contract – adjudicator found that there was a construction contract between claimant and builder – builder under no obligation to perform work – whether a contract existed – whether adjudicator had jurisdiction to make decision -  ADMINISTRATIVE LAW – JUDICIAL REVIEW – GROUNDS OF REVIEW – PROCEDURAL FAIRNESS – EXCLUSION OF PROCEDURAL FAIRNESS – GENERALLY – application to review adjudication decision under Building and Construction Industry Payments Act 2004 – adjudicator made a finding as to existence of a contract – finding on a basis not suggested by applicant or respondent – applicant denied the opportunity to be heard – whether a fair hearing denied to the applicant
